I’ve canceled Marley Spoon twice. Once because the $126/week math stopped making sense when I wasn’t cooking everything before it went bad. Once because I needed a break from deciding what to eat every single week. Both times, the process was straightforward. no phone calls, no retention team trying to keep you hostage.

Maybe you’re canceling because the recipes take longer than 30 minutes (they do, if you’re not already comfortable in a kitchen). Maybe you found something cheaper. Maybe you’re just tired of meal kit life and want to go back to winging it at Trader Joe’s. No judgment. Here’s exactly how to cancel Marley Spoon in 2026, what happens when you do, and whether pausing makes more sense than burning the whole thing down.
